Which feature allows different flow elements to communicate with each other?

Flow Connectors are essential for enabling communication between different flow elements within a flow. They serve as the pathways that link various flow elements such as screens, actions, and decisions, allowing the flow to transition smoothly from one element to another. By using connectors, a flow can define the order of execution and the relationship between the elements, thus facilitating a coherent workflow.

The use of connectors is critical for structuring the flow logically, ensuring that information can be passed along and that conditions for decision-making can be clearly defined. This feature is fundamental in crafting a user experience that feels seamless and intuitive, guiding the user through the intended process without interruptions or confusion.

In contrast, other options like flow variables, flow logs, and flow templates serve different purposes. Flow variables are utilized for storing data and can hold values, but they do not inherently create connections between elements. Flow logs are used for tracking the execution of flows for debugging or monitoring purposes, and please templates provide predefined structures for flows but do not facilitate the communication between elements in the workflow. Thus, the capability to communicate and direct the flow dynamics comes specifically from flow connectors.
